Americans Unite to Support Local Businesses Amid Economic Challenges
Washington, D.C. – Today (November 29, 2025), the United States celebrates "Small Business Saturday," now in its 16th year. Held on the first Saturday after Thanksgiving, this event encourages consumers to support and shop at small businesses in their own communities—the lifeblood of local economies. Cyclone "Ditwah" Devastates Sri Lanka: 123 Dead, Government Declares State of Emergency
Colombo, Sri Lanka – Sri Lanka is facing a national crisis after Cyclone Ditwah, a high-intensity storm, made landfall and devastated the country's eastern and northern coastal regions, leaving behind a trail of massive destruction. The government has officially confirmed at least 123 deaths, with more than 130 people still missing. Flood crisis kills more than 400, Indonesia suffers the worst damage
Southeast Asia is facing one of its worst natural disasters in decades after unprecedented rains triggered widespread flooding and mudslides across several countries, particularly in Indonesia, Malaysia, Vietnam and southern Thailand. The death toll from all countries has now surpassed 400 and is expected to rise further, with millions of people in crisis. Airbus orders emergency A320neo updates worldwide after cosmic radiation risk detected
PARIS, France – The global aviation industry is facing a significant challenge as Airbus has issued an Emergency Airworthiness Directive (EAD) requiring airlines worldwide to urgently update nearly 6,000 of its A320neo Family aircraft with flight control software. The reason for the announcement is not a mechanical defect, but a risk from a natural phenomenon known as "cosmic rays."
